Salsa de Dre

Ingredients:
3 ripe Italian plum tomatoes, chopped finely
1/3 medium-sized yellow bell pepper, chopped finely
1/4 medium-sized red onion, chopped finely
1 jalepeno pepper, chopped finely, seeds and all
1 orange Hot wax pepper, chopped finely
3-4 pickled red jalepeno peppers, chopped finely
bunch of fresh cilantro, chopped
juice of 1/2 fresh lime
2 cloves garlic, finely chopped

Instructions:
Throw it together in a bowl, yo!
